Output 366d231dadb19663e5915f64303c5105a03115d36e4d212c1615aca7a28bb7e3:14

value
19985000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5f1625c4c57006c04c7337bf24420c5f9149848f OP_EQUALVERIFY OP_CHECKSIG
address
19fmj4ZvhDXMUgnTWNPDhirengQFvBGZeB
transaction
366d231dadb19663e5915f64303c5105a03115d36e4d212c1615aca7a28bb7e3
spent
true